Changelog 3.8.1 — Renamed `RESOLVER_RETRY_MODE` to `DNS_RETRY_STRATEGY` in the Quellstone edge service. The old name silently fell back to a single-attempt resolver, which caused the intermittent lookup failures reported from the Ostermark region last sprint. Release manager: the migration script rewrites the key automatically, but it does not carry over the upstream resolver credential, which must be re-entered by hand. After the renamed setting, the env file's next line sets that resolver authentication secret.

env line for fafof-fahag: LEDGER_TOKEN5=f8790

Ticket: Staging env misconfigured for Siftgate bloom filter

The bloom layer in front of the Pellet KV store is rejecting all lookups in staging because the env file was copied from the dev template without credentials. False-positive tuning values are fine; only the auth line is missing. To unblock the weekly demo, the Pellet admission secret must be set on the following line.

env line for yaguf-fajop: LEDGER_TOKEN13=fb08984397349

**Off-site run checklist — Calibration weights to Dunsmere Instruments**

For the office manager: confirm the batch of calibration weights from our metrology room is packed in the padded transit case with the inventory sheet inside the lid. Record the case count in the run log before the driver leaves, and note the expected return date for the certified set. Dunsmere's goods-in desk closes at 15:30, so schedule accordingly. The hand-over at Dunsmere must follow the confidential instruction below.

handover note for yagef-bagep: the drudor pelius courier leaves the kasdor zorvan norir ledger at gate 8016 under passcode 755406

Ticket: config drift in Tallyforge's spreadsheet export workers. Staging and production have diverged — staging was hand-edited during the memory incident last quarter and never reconciled. Exports over roughly 40k rows now OOM in staging but not production, which makes repro confusing for anyone new. Please reconcile against the canonical values. The intended production configuration is listed below.

config for kafof-bawef:
holath:
  log_level: debug
  metrics_host: metrics.holath.qorvelsys.internal
  pin: 2191
  pool_size: 32